The Wichita State Shockers and the Creighton Bluejays are likely already in the NCAA tournament, but they can solidify their standing as at-large teams and improve their seeding considerably with wins on Saturday. The top two teams in the Missouri Valley Conference won in the tournament quarterfinals on Friday, though they did it in completely different circumstances.
Wichita State defeated Indiana State convincingly, while Creighton struggled with Drake. Both teams will be up against better teams in the semifinals, and if regular season results are any indication, both games should be reasonably close.
Creighton face the Evansville Aces, who beat the Missouri State Bears to make the semifinals. Creighton lost away to Evansville in the regular season and just barely held on for an overtime win over the Aces in Omaha. Wichita State faces the Illinois State Redbirds, who they beat twice in the regular season. However, the Redbirds lost by just three points in Wichita.
